Why St. Louis Homes Are Prone to Leaks
St. Louis presents a perfect storm of conditions that make plumbing leaks a frequent concern for homeowners. The primary culprits are the region's expansive clay soil, which shifts with moisture changes and can put immense pressure on underground pipes and home foundations, leading to slab leaks. Furthermore, many neighborhoods have older homes with original galvanized steel or copper piping that has corroded or developed pinhole leaks over decades 1. Finally, the area's freeze-thaw cycles each winter can cause pipes to burst, especially in uninsulated crawl spaces or exterior walls. Addressing these issues promptly with expert water leak detection is essential to maintaining your home's integrity.
Common Types of Leaks in the St. Louis Area
Professional plumbers in St. Louis categorize leaks by their location, as each type requires a different approach for detection and repair.
- Slab or Foundation Leaks: Perhaps the most notorious leak in the region, a slab leak occurs when the water line running beneath your home's concrete foundation springs a leak. Signs include unexplained warm spots on your floor, a sudden spike in your water bill, or the sound of running water when all fixtures are off 2. The shifting soil common in St. Louis is a leading cause.
- Leaks in Walls and Ceilings: These are often caused by pinhole leaks in aging copper pipes or corroded galvanized pipes 3. You might notice water stains, bubbling paint or drywall, musty odors, or mold growth. Because the leak is hidden, specialized equipment is needed to pinpoint it without tearing down entire walls.
- Underground or Yard Leaks: This involves the main water supply line from the street to your house or the sewer lateral line. Symptoms include soggy patches in your yard (even during dry weather), sinkholes, or sewage backups. Tree roots seeking moisture are a common cause of damage to these lines 4.
- Fixture and Appliance Leaks: These are typically more accessible and include a constantly running toilet due to a worn flapper, a leaking water heater, or loose connections behind your washing machine or dishwasher 5. While often easier to fix, they can still waste a significant amount of water.
The Professional Leak Detection Process
Local specialists like American Leak Detection, Hoffmann Brothers, and Anton's Plumbing follow a methodical, non-invasive process to find leaks with minimal disruption to your home 6 7 8.
- Initial Assessment: The technician will discuss your symptoms, review your water usage history, and perform a visual inspection for common signs like moisture, mold, or water stains.
- Water Meter Test: A fundamental check involves turning off all water in the home and observing the water meter. If the meter continues to move, it confirms a leak is present somewhere in the system 9.
- Advanced Technology Pinpointing: This is the core of modern leak detection. Technicians use tools like:
- Acoustic Listening Devices: Amplify the sound of water escaping under pressure to locate its source behind walls or under slabs 10 11.
- Thermal Imaging Cameras: Detect temperature differences caused by moisture, revealing hidden leaks inside walls or in ceilings 12.
- Moisture Mapping Equipment: Measures the exact moisture content in materials to define the full extent of water damage.
- Camera Inspection: For suspected drain or sewer line problems, a flexible fiber-optic camera is snaked through the pipes. This provides a real-time video feed to identify cracks, blockages, or root intrusions deep within your plumbing system 13.
Repair Techniques for Different Leaks
Once the leak is precisely located, the repair strategy depends on its type and location.
- Slab Leak Repairs: The goal is to fix the pipe with minimal destruction of your concrete floor. Trenchless pipe lining is a common solution, where a new epoxy-coated liner is inserted through the existing pipe, creating a "pipe within a pipe" without major excavation 14. For more severe cases, a small, targeted section of the concrete may be removed to access and replace the pipe.
- Underground Pipe Repairs: For water mains or sewer lines in the yard, traditional excavation is often required to remove and replace the damaged section. Some companies may offer trenchless options like pipe bursting if the situation allows.
- Wall and Ceiling Repairs: After the leaky pipe section is repaired (often by replacing a segment or using a repair clamp), the affected drywall or plaster is cut out, new piping is installed, and the area is patched and repainted.
- Timeline: Simple, accessible leaks might be repaired in a few hours. Complex slab leaks or full pipe relining projects can take 1 to 3 days to complete 15.

Understanding Costs for Leak Detection and Repair
Costs in St. Louis vary widely based on the leak's location, accessibility, and the required repair method. Here's a general breakdown based on local service data:
- Inspection/Service Fee: Most companies charge a diagnostic or trip fee, typically starting in the range of $110 to $150 just to come out and begin the detection process 16 17.
- Advanced Detection Services: The specialized, non-invasive detection work using acoustic, thermal, and gas detection equipment can cost several hundred dollars, but this investment often saves thousands by avoiding unnecessary demolition 18.
- Repair Costs: A minor, accessible leak repair (like a valve or joint) may cost in the lower hundreds. However, major repairs like fixing a slab leak or excavating and replacing a main water line can range from $1,500 to several thousand dollars depending on the depth, length, and obstacles involved 19 20.
- Potential Discounts: It's worth asking about promotions. Some local plumbers offer discounts for first-time customers or specific services.
Local Service Insights and Prevention Tips
- Emergency Services: Given the risk of burst pipes in winter, many St. Louis firms like Flow King Rooter and Anton's Plumbing offer 24/7 emergency leak repair services 21.
- Seasonal Preparation: The best repair is prevention. Before winter, insulate pipes in unheated areas like basements, garages, and crawl spaces. Disconnect and drain outdoor hoses. Knowing where your main water shut-off valve is located can prevent catastrophic water damage in an emergency 22.
- Free Initial Checks: Some local companies, like Maplewood Plumbing, may offer a quick, free initial assessment if a technician is in your area, to help confirm a leak issue before a full diagnostic is scheduled 23.
